Bonds, Barry
Entry from US Dictionary
Pronunciation: /bändz/
- (1964-), US baseball player; full name Barry Lamar Bonds. The winner of seven National League Most Valuable Player awards (1990, 1992, 1993, 2001, 2002, 2003, 2004), he played for the Pittsburgh Pirates 1986–1992 and the San Francisco Giants from 1993. In 2007, he eclipsed the home run record (755) of Hank Aaron.
